| along the icv trail near the town of sagamore.the town is all but gone now just a couple of patch houses.named after the sagamore mining company the town accomadated the miners and their families.the best way to get to the cache is by parking at cw resh park in indian head the coords are n40 01.570 w079 23.748.the park has pavillions'playgrounds'and a ballfield.back creek runs through the middle of the park.this section of the creek is reserved for kids 12 and under and the disabled for fishing.it's a great place for the young angler cachers to get a chance at catching a big one.the cache is an ammo can have fun be safe see ya soon... |
